Claude Debussy (1862 – 1918)
Estampes - Jardins sous la pluie. Net et vif.
L. 100/3 (1903)
Nikolai Lugansky, 2019
Mariinsky Theatre

“… Finally back to France for these ‘Jardins sous la pluie’ (Gardens in the Rain) where, during a stay in Orbec of Calvados, Debussy transcribed the raindrops or the song of birds, mixing in two popular melodies - ‘nous n’irons plus au bois’ and 'do, do l’enfant do’ - to compose this melancholy painting.”

- From FranceMusique (translated)
